Yamaha Nytro XTX





This past weekend I ran the Nytro XTX for 300km in -20C weather between Sprucedale and Moon River.The bottom end torque allows this sled to run right with the Crossfire 800 we also had on the trip. Only on the lakes does the Crossfire have the legs to outrun the Nytro.





This is the 144" version of the Nytro. The Nytro delivered 20 mpg all day and the the skidframe on this baby just soaks up the moguls. The rear portion of the skidframe is kicked up so on the trail the amount of track is similar to a 121" which makes it a little easier to handle the tight and twisties.
